St. Joseph’s Table
Mission Statement The tradition of St. Joseph’s Table, which dates from the Middle Ages, honors St. Joseph, the foster father of Jesus Christ and patron of the Universal Church. At Holy Family, the annual celebration, organized entirely by parishioners, supports the Giving Bank and the Society of St. Vincent de Paul.
